Abstract
- An improved pulse compression technique was developed for long range testing using dispersive guided waves. This technique improves signal-to-noise ratio (SNR) of the guided wave signals and compensates for the wave distortion caused by dispersion characteristics of the guided wave. A fast calculation algorism was designed. It consists of integrations of both cross-correlation for pulse compression and compensation of velocity dispersion in wave number domain. Efficiency of the technique was verified experimentally, in which the results showed both spatial resolution and signal-to-noise ratio were improved.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
